Abstract

The defrosting control strategy plays a critical role in influencing the heating performance and reliability of air source heat pump (ASHP). However, there is still a lack of a practical criterion to evaluate the defrosting initiation time accuracy. To solve this problem, an experimental bench was built, and the frosting-defrosting experiments using twenty-one ASHPs from nine manufacturers were conducted. Based on the variation characteristics of energy loss caused by frosting-defrosting, a new testing method, double-cycle method, was developed, which can determine the optimal defrosting initiation time by only two frosting-defrosting processes. Then, utilizing this method, the operation performance distribution at the optimal defrosting initiation time was analyzed, and an evaluation criterion for defrosting initiation time accuracy based on the attenuation rate of heating capacity was proposed. Results showed that the proposed double-cycle method can determine the optimal defrosting initiation time quickly and accurately. It can reduce the experimental duration for determining the optimal defrosting initiation time by 47.56 –56.64 %, and the relative errors in 90% of the experiments were within 5%. Then, by analyzing the operation parameters using this method, a new evaluation criterion, the attenuation rate of 5–20% in heating capacity, was proposed for defrosting initiation time accuracy.
